A lit flare in front of the elevator can be useful as it keeps you from needing your flashlight, which would drain your sprint meter, and can be used to light up zombies which in turn are light sources.
Stockpiling cinderblocks, barrels, rubble, and medkits near the elevator before the zombies begin attacking in full force is useful also make sure to grab the occasional flare from wherever it may be lying around. The elevator sequence at the end of the chapter is one of the most hectic parts of any Half-life game, and it doesn't help that it's pitch black. Zombines will eventually blow themselves up, and Alyx has a gun whose bullets (obviously) don't count, so make sure to let her shoot the zombies for you. Flares are also helpful, but burn out after a short period of time and so should be activated with caution.
